Renormalisation in Open Quantum Field theory II: Yukawa theory and PV reduction

Abstract

We compute Passarino-Veltman (PV) reduction for tensor loop integrals, that appear in open field theories. We apply these results to open-Yukawa theory and compute the self-energy correction of the fields. We found that non-local divergences show up in the one loop correction to the fermionic self-energy. These non-local divergences do not disappear even if the tree level theory is chosen to satisfy the trace preserving condition of the density matrix.
